#36424c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36424c is composed of 21.2% red, 25.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 207.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.9% and a lightness of 25.5%. #36424c color hex could be obtained by blending #6c8498 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#36424c color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#36424c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36424c has RGB values of R:54, G:66,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3555916.

Shades and Tints of #36424c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050607 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#36424c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404142 is the less saturated color, while #04477e is the most saturated one.
